In Texas, a city divided over illegal immigration – Farmers Branch
Tagged: Farmers Branch, TexasPosted on: January 18th, 2007“As the nation paused to remember Martin Luther King Jr.s hope for brotherhood across racial lines this week, a Dallas suburbs struggle with illegal immigration suggests that some issues can still divide people into feuding groups marked mostly by ethnicity.
This time many see the turmoil in Farmers Branch as a dispute between Anglos and Hispanics. Tempers have blazed so intensely that people on both sides fear that the City Hall screaming matches could escalate into fistfights.”
